    You can now endorse preprints as robust, clear, and exciting using Plaudit, a service originating from . Identities confirmed via Try it out on this randomly selected preprint or on any other on OSF preprint services.

    Accessible software is software can be properly used by people with various disabilities - which unfortunately is not a given. Physical disabilities should not deter someone from taking part in the scientific process, and Plaudit should be usable by any and all academics.
